Commitment to our guiding principles: As FLÖ, we have the following guiding principles:
- The Promotion of democracy in all areas of society, both in internal working methods through the creation of low-threshold structures for opinion-forming and through transparent action, as well as in political work through advocacy for strong democratic structures, particularly those that enable student participation.
- The Inclusion and equality of all people and the fight against all forms of discrimination. This includes in particular the removal and visibility of barriers and structural hurdles, as well as the pursuit of equal opportunities. The pursuit of this goal should be directed both internally and externally.
- The Commitment to social responsibility of student representations and universities. This includes political work for students in all life situations, particularly in the areas of education, social affairs, community, inclusion and equality, culture, sustainability, environment and climate, science and research ethics, health, with the focus on students.
- The Strengthening independence, both in internal working methods in accordance with the independence requirement, and in political work through advocacy for the independence of student representations and universities.
All further substantive orientations of the university groups are entirely at the discretion of the local group and are not influenced by FLÖ.
